To calculate the average AR, total the opening and closing balance and divide it by two. The companies must note the balances over a period. It could be monthly, quarterly, or annually. Formula: Average Accounts Receivable = (Opening Balance + Closing Balance)/ 2. Web8 jan. 2024 · Accounts receivable (AR) are the amounts owed by customers for goods or services purchased on credit. The money owed to the company is called 'accounts receivable' and is tracked as an account in the general ledger, and then reported as a line on the balance sheet.
